Chef Paul Routhier will work with you to design and craft foods for your event ... Web13 apr. 2024 · To the right of the plate, place the knife closest to the plate, blade pointing in. Place the spoon to the right of the knife. (Note: The bottoms of the utensils and the plate should all be level.) Place the water glass slightly above the plate, in between the plate and the utensils, about where 1 p.m. would be on a clock face.
